/* CSS Document */

html, body {
	font-family: 'Open Sans', sans-serif, 'FuturaStd-CondensedBold';
	font-size: 0.9rem;
}
table{
	width: 100%;
}
td{
	line-height: 1.0;
}
.div_varcompare .variety-selected, #maincontent .div_varcompare .varnav .variety-selected:hover {
	background-color: #9DC84B;
}
.div_varcompare td {
	text-align: center;
	font-size: 13px;
}
.div_varcompare .left-table td:first-child {
	border-right: #9DC84B solid 1px;
	text-align: left;
}
.div_varcompare th {
	font-size: 15px;
	text-align: left;
	background-color: #9DC84B;
	color: #FFFFFF;
	padding-top: 1px;
}
.div_varcompare .noc {
	/*background-color: #FFFFFF;*/
	width: 250px;
	min-width: 250px;
}
.div_varcompare .noc, .div_varcompare .left-table .noc, .div_varcompare .left-table:first-child .noc {
	border-right: none;
}
.fancybox-skin {
	border-radius: 0px;
}
.div_varcompare .snrot {
	text-align: left;
}
.div_varcompare .varname .cgrey {
	text-align: left;
	line-height: none;
}

.div_varcompare .left-table {
	float:left;
}

.div_varcompare .right-table {
	float:left;	
	overflow:auto;
}

.div_varcompare, .div_varcompare .zeile {
	width:100%;
	max-width:100%;
	overflow:hidden;	
}
.varcompare_button {
	color:#666;
	text-decoration:underline;
	font-size:11pt;	
}

#mainleft #varcompare_leftblock {
	margin-bottom: 30px;
}

.vc-table 	{border:1px solid #DEDEDE;padding: 10px;}
.vc-head 		{background-color: #96C038;border-bottom:1px solid #DEDEDE;margin-top:10px;}
.vc-head1 	{color: #b91e1d;font-size: 1.3em;font-weight: 600;}
.vc-head2		{color: #b91e1d;font-size: 0.7em;}
.vc-tdname 	{max-width: 180px;min-width: 150px;}
.text1 		{font-size:0.8em;}
.text3 		{font-size:0.8em;}
.vc-info 		{font-size: 0.8em;}
.vc-noc 		{vertical-align: baseline;}